First Medicare is composed of two fundamental parts; Part An and Part B. Medicare part A contains all hospital expenses, including hospital stays and any other expense and that be incurred inside a hospital. Medicare Part B covers any expenses that occur in a physician ‘s office ; outpatient surgeries, such as MRIs, Ct Scans, Etc. Jointly B & Medicare part A make-up initial Medicare.
Medicare does not cover 100% of your medical bills. Overall, Medicare covers about 80% of medical expenses. This leaves the remaining 20% that isn’t covered. As people get mature health problems can appear and more medical bills can be incurred. With just Medicare and no Medigap or Medicare Supplement Plan you are able to face a large bill that is 20% of the total invoice. 20% of a bill that is very big is still a very large bill. This is why many people choose to get a Medicare Supplement Plan to help protect them against the high cost that can occur from a hospital stay or other medical expense.
Overview Of Medigap Plans
There are 10 standardized Medigap insurance plans to choose from. These insurance plans are controlled by the US government Medicare and are made to work with First Medicare to pay for what Original Medicare doesn’t cover in full (the 20% that is left over). Medicare supplement plans are identified by a plan letter A-N. Because the insurance plans controlled and are standardized, the advantages are the same no matter what business is offering the Medigap insurance. The only difference between precisely the same Medigap insurance plan letter with different businesses is the price. As an example, a Plan F with Aetna and a Plan F with AARP are the same the only difference between them is the price the insurance companies charge.. .. Medigap Insurance Plan F
Medicare Supplement Plan F is among the very popular addition insurance plans. This Medigap plan covers 100% of everything that is left over by Original Medicare. For example, F covers whatever happens in a doctor ‘s office or every other medical facility at 100%, all hospital bills, and the Part A deductible. This can be the only plan that offers full coverage that is all-inclusive to 100%.
Medigap Insurance Plan G
Medicare Supplement Plan G is a plan we like to advocate the most and often known as the Gold Plan. It’s virtually identical to Plan F. The only difference is a yearly deductible of $166 for the year on Plan G. Other than that the gains are exactly the same as Plan F. The reason we like Plan G is because the premiums are substantially less than Plan F.
Medigap Plan N
This Medigap Plan is great for people who would like to love a lower premium still have nearly complete coverage at the hospital and other high medical bills that can happen.

When Is The Best Time To Purchase A Medigap Plan?
When you’re first eligible for Medicare; during your open enrollment for Medigap the best time to purchase Medicare Supplement Plan is. During this time which starts continue for six months and six months before your 65th birthday after your 65th birthday it is possible to join a Medicare Supplement Plan regardless of your health. There aren’t any questions for pre existing conditions and it is possible to get any Medigap plan you need from any carrier
If you are past the age of 65 and looking get an idea for the very first time or to change plans you may need to answer some basic health questions to qualify. Most people and qualify so you should still be able to get a insurance plan.
